Transaction d63c77c5ed77e2f99ede9a2a8127939fa3560245481f2a223d07ff143afba641

2 Input
1 Outputs
  • d63c77c5ed77e2f99ede9a2a8127939fa3560245481f2a223d07ff143afba641:0
  • value  1650673
    address  1MVdDd22pEUxdP287wPCGGydtZgwiEeXyX